Abstract: Abstract QFD analysis of the installation process of the gearbox locking mechanism for “Nissan” cars (“Garant Consul”) with account of the competition factors and the Weber-Fechner law.

Keywords: Quality function deployment; Weber-Fechner law; Customers’ requirements (search for similar items in EconPapers)
